Vettel admits he is his own worst enemy

Sebastian Vettel has made plenty of mistakes this year as he looks to chase that elusive fifth world title and admits that he and Ferrari need to look at themselves if they want to win the titles this season. Vettel currently trails Hamilton by 30 points in the drivers’ standings, with Mercedes also ahead in the Constructors’ standings, by 25 points. With seven rounds remaining, it is still possible for a turnaround, but it will take a serious loss of form from Hamilton and a big turnaround by Ferrari if that is to happen.
